A deterministic axial vector model for photons is presented which is suitable also for particles. During a rotation around an axis the deterministic wave function a has the following form a = ws r exp(+-i wb t). ws is either the axial or scalar spin rotation frequency (the latter is proportional to the mass), r radius of the orbit (also amplitude of a vibration arising later from the interaction by fusing of two oppositely circling photons), wb orbital angular frequency (proportional to the velocity) and t time. "+" before the imaginary i means a right-handed and "-" a left-handed rotation. An interaction happens if particles (including the photons) meet themselves through collision and melt together. ----- Es wird ein deterministisches Drehvektor-Modell fuer Photonen vorgestellt, das auch fuer Teilchen geeignet ist.
